What is Ohio Pretrial Order
The Ohio Final Pretrial Order is a legal document used by plaintiffs and defendants to outline the procedures and deadlines for a civil trial in Ohio.

Who can use the Ohio Final Pretrial Order?
The Ohio Final Pretrial Order can be used by plaintiffs and defendants involved in civil trials in Ohio, as well as attorneys and legal representatives managing the trial preparation process.
What information do I need to complete this form?
You will need details such as plaintiff and defendant names, case number, trial date, deadlines for discovery, and witness information to accurately complete the Ohio Final Pretrial Order.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Ohio Final Pretrial Order?
The Ohio Final Pretrial Order must typically be filed prior to the trial date. Specific deadlines can vary based on court procedures, so it's essential to check with your local court.

Are there any fees associated with filing this document?
While the form itself does not have a fee, submitting court documents may involve filing fees set by the local court, which can vary by jurisdiction.
Can I edit the Ohio Final Pretrial Order after submission?
Once you submit the Ohio Final Pretrial Order, it generally cannot be altered. You may need to file a motion for any amendments with the court.
What are common mistakes to avoid when completing this form?
Common mistakes include missing required fields, providing incorrect case numbers, and not adhering to specified deadlines. Always review your information carefully before submission.
